Board and batten installation involves adding a distinctive siding style that features wide vertical boards (the “boards”) paired with narrower strips (the “battens”) placed over the seams. This method creates a classic, textured look that can significantly enhance the exterior appearance of a home or building. The installation process typically includes attaching the vertical boards to the structure, then covering the joints with the battens for a clean, finished appearance. This style is popular for its durability, visual appeal, and the ability to customize the pattern and materials to match different architectural styles.

The overview below groups typical Board And Batten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Independence,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or board and batten repairs or touch-ups range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for small sections or single walls. Larger or more complex repairs can sometimes exceed this amount.
Partial Installation - Installing board and batten on a single wall or a small area us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Most projects of this scope fall into this middle range, with fewer reaching the higher end for additional customization or prep work.
Full Wall or Room Installation - Complete installation of board and batten on an entire room often ranges from $1,500 to $3,500. Many local contractors handle projects within this band, though larger or more detailed jobs can go higher.
Full Replacement or Large-Scale Projects - Replacing existing siding or undertaking extensive coverage can cost $3,500 to $8,000 or more. These larger, more complex projects are less common and typically involve higher material and labor cost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is board and batten installation? Board and batten installation involves adding vertical wooden or composite siding panels with narrower strips, called battens, covering the seams to create a distinctive, textured exterior or interior look.
What are the benefits of choosing board and batten siding? This siding style offers a classic aesthetic, adds visual interest to walls, and can enhance the curb appeal of a property in Independence, MO and nearby areas.
Can board and batten be installed on different types of buildings? Yes, local contractors can install board and batten on residential homes, garages, sheds, and other structures, adapting the method to suit various building types.
What materials are used for board and batten installation? Common materials include wood, fiber cement, vinyl, and composite panels, with the choice depending on the desired look and durability needs.
Is board and batten installation suitable for interior walls? Yes, many homeowners use this style for interior accent walls or paneling to add texture and a rustic or modern touch to interior spaces.
